25.   Restrictions regarding disclosure of data subject information

  1.  

    (1)   On the recommendation of the Central Bank, the Minister may, by Regulations, make provision with respect to the disclosure and protection of data subject information under this Act.

  1.  

    (2)   Where a credit bureau obtains credit information regarding credit extended to or in respect of a data subject, the credit bureau shall not disclose such information for a period longer than 7 years after the date of termination or settlement of such credit.

  1.  

    (3)   Notwithstanding subsection (2) a credit bureau may, for historical, statistical or research purposes, retain data subject information for a period in excess of 7 years.

  1.  

    (4)   The Central Bank may issue guidelines with respect to the term of retention of negative information and the calculation of the period of retention.

  1.  

    (5)   A credit bureau that contravenes subsection (2) commits an offence and is liable on summary conviction to a fine not less than $10 000 but not exceeding $100 000.
